Oil and Natural Gas Corporation Limited (hereinafter referred to as 'ONGC') issued advertisement dated 03.01.2008 inviting applications for appointment to the post of 'Field Officer'. The 1st petitioner and several others applied for the said post. In the selection, 285 candidates were selected and appointed, whereas the 1st petitioner was not selected. The 1st petitioner and 16 others filed W.P.No.17355 of 2008 before this Court challenging the selection.
The 2nd petitioner is a practicing advocate. On behalf of the 1st petitioner he filed an application under the Right to Information Act, 2005 (hereinafter referred to as 'the Act'), before the 1st respondent seeking information on three aspects namely, (1) the number of SC candidates selected; (2) the name of the authority who selected the candidates; and (3) the date of issue of posting orders to 285 candidates and their dates of joining. He has also made a request to furnish copies of the qualification certificates submitted by the selected candidates.
